Circle Coordinate Geometry Questions
a. The radius length of the circle whose centre is the origin and passes through the point \((-3, 4)\) equals ...... length units.
(a) 3
(b) 4
(c) 5
(d) 7

b. If AB is a diameter in a circle where A \((3, -5)\), B \((5, 1)\), then the centre of the circle is ......
(a) \((4, -2)\)
(b) \((4, 2)\)
(c) \((2, 2)\)
(d) \((8, -2)\)

c. AB is a diameter in a circle whose centre is the origin, where A = \((2, 0)\), then B = ......
(a) \((2, 2)\)
(b) \((0, -2)\)
(c) \((-2, 0)\)
(d) \((-2, 2)\)

a. (c) 5
b. (a) \((4, -2)\)
c. (c) \((-2, 0)\)
